For DU CSAS PG counselling round 2, a total of 5415 allocations were made, out of which 3833 allocations were fresh allocations. Further, 1386 candidates got upgraded seats and 3436 students opted for freeze during round 1 counselling.
Particulars | Details |
---|---|
Total Allocations | 5415 |
Fresh allocations | 3833 |
Candidates who have got upgraded seat | 1386 |
Candidates who had opted for freeze in Round 1 | 3436 |
Candidates who have accepted their seat ( till 5:25 pm) | 1914 |

The table below shows the various specialisations offered by top MBA colleges accepting CUET PG in India along with their number of colleges:
Top Specialisations | No. of Colleges |
---|---|
Finance | 158 |
Sales & Marketing | 148 |
Human Resources | 147 |
International Business | 94 |
IT & Systems | 88 |
